Introduction  \n1. IDA Deputies and Borrower Representatives (Participants) met virtually on October 20–22, 2021 for the Mid-Term Review (MTR) of IDA19 and to discuss the IDA20 policy commitments, results framework, and financing package. The meeting was co-chaired by Mr. Axel van Trotsenburg, World Bank Managing Director of Operations, and Mr. Denny Kalyalya, the IDA20 Independent Co-Chair. Representatives from the African Development Bank, the Asian Development Bank, the Inter-American Development Bank, and the International Fund for Agricultural Development joined the meeting as observers. In preparation for the meeting, Management circulated  \n12 IDA papers to inform the discussion (see Annex 1) . Participants shared detailed written comments prior to the meeting, some of which were addressed by Management in the Staff Written Statement.  \n2. Mr. van Trotsenburg thanked Participants for the strong support expressed for the IDA20 policy and financing package. He reminded Participants of the significant financing needs in IDA countries in response to the impacts ofthe Coronavirus Disease 2019 (COVID-19) . This was strongly articulated at the “IDA for Africa: High-Level Meeting of Heads of State” hosted by President Ouattara in Abidjan on July 15, 2021, where 23 African Heads of States co-signed a declaration calling for an ambitious IDA20 Replenishment of at least $100 billion. IDA Borrower Representatives had made a similar call in their joint statement issued prior to the meeting. Mr. van Trotsenburg thanked the independent Co-Chair, Mr. Kalyalya, for agreeing to help see the IDA20 Replenishment process through, even with his added new responsibilities as Bank of Zambia Governor.  \n3. Mr. Kalyalya underscored that, despite the comprehensive and accelerated support by IDA, IDA countries were still lagging in COVID-19 vaccinations and economic recovery. He noted that an ambitious and successful IDA20 replenishment would be critical to providing the grants and concessional financing that the poorest countries needed to recover and build a green, resilient, and inclusive future.  \nB. IDA19 Mid-Term Review  \n4. Mr. Ed Mountfield, Vice President of Operations Policy and Country Services, summarized the robust results during the first year of IDA19, including the strong progress on the delivery of the IDA19 policy commitments, despite the shorter IDA19 cycle. He noted that IDA’s COVID-19 crisis response, which included 43 national vaccination programs, was unprecedented in scale and speed, and represented the largest share of the multilateral response to COVID-19 for IDA countries. Disbursements in the IDA portfolio had not slowed down, and the portfolio was as effective as ever, with IEG’s independent ratings of IDA’s operational outcomes rising to nearly 80 percent satisfactory. IDA was able to sustain focus on long-term development priorities, including climate, debt, fragility and gender. Notwithstanding IDA19 shorter cycle, IDA was on track to meet or exceed nearly every IDA19 policy commitment and IDA Results Management System (RMS) targets.  \n5. Mr. Akihiko Nishio, Vice President of Development Finance, highlighted the strong financial delivery in IDA19, with almost $39 billion delivered as of end of September 2021. Of this amount, more than $27 billion went to Sub-Saharan Africa and $16 billion to IDA countries characterized as Fragile and Conflict-affected Situations (FCS) . He observed that demand for IDA resources remained high with a strong pipeline for the rest ofFY22, which exceeded the amount ofresources available in the IDA19 envelope.
